Chroniclers have been tracing the historical evolution of organized higher learning since its formation in Europe and England in the 11th and 12th centuries CE. In the American context, “house histories” of varying quality and accuracy likewise accompanied the founding of the first colonial colleges in the 17th century. WebbMilestones in the history of public education. Create the idea of public schools. In the 1850s, Horace Mann popularized the idea of public schools in America. He was inspired by schools in Prussia. In the 1870s, President Ulysses Grant campaigned to make public education a Constitutional right. The effort failed, but some states adopted it.
